首页 > 新闻 > 手机新闻 > 正文

数据驱动的设计,怎样在App里开发智能推荐系统

看不見的法師
发布: 2025-05-18 13:48:23
原创
904人浏览过

智能推荐系统作为提升用户体验和增强用户粘性的关键工具,逐渐成为app开发的重点。一个高效且准确的推荐系统不仅能为用户提供个性化内容,还能推动app内的消费和互动,提升整体商业价值。本文将深入探讨如何通过数据驱动的设计理念,开发一个智能推荐系统,为您的app注入新的活力。

数据驱动的设计,怎样在App里开发智能推荐系统一.理解数据驱动的设计

数据驱动的设计是基于用户行为数据、偏好数据以及App内部数据等多维度信息,进行产品设计、优化和决策的过程。在智能推荐系统的开发中,数据处于核心地位。通过收集和分析用户在使用App过程中的各种数据,我们可以更深入地了解用户需求,从而为用户提供更加精准和个性化的推荐内容。

二.构建智能推荐系统的关键步骤

‌数据收集与整理

开发智能推荐系统的第一步是收集用户数据,包括用户的基本信息(如年龄、性别、所在地区);行为数据(如浏览、点击、购买);以及偏好数据(如喜欢的类型、品牌等)。同时,还需要收集App内部的内容数据,例如商品信息、文章标签等。这些数据将成为推荐系统的基础输入。

数据预处理与特征提取

收集到的原始数据通常是不规则和不完整的。因此,需要进行数据预处理,包括数据清洗、去重、归一化等步骤。随后通过特征提取技术,将原始数据转换为推荐系统能够理解的格式,如用户特征向量、内容特征向量等。

选择推荐算法

创客贴设计
创客贴设计

创客贴设计,一款智能在线设计工具,设计不求人,AI助你零基础完成专业设计!

创客贴设计 51
查看详情 创客贴设计

推荐算法是智能推荐系统的核心。常见的推荐算法包括基于内容的推荐、协同过滤推荐、深度学习推荐等。根据App的具体需求和用户特点,选择合适的推荐算法是至关重要的。例如,对于内容丰富的App,基于内容的推荐可能更合适;而对于用户互动频繁的App,协同过滤推荐可能效果更好。

模型训练与优化

选定推荐算法后,需要利用历史数据对模型进行训练。通过持续迭代和优化,使模型能够更准确地预测用户的喜好。同时,还需要关注模型的实时性、可扩展性等性能指标,以确保推荐系统在实际应用中稳定运行。

‌推荐结果评估与反馈

推荐系统的效果需要通过实际数据来评估。可以通过设置AB测试,同时进行用户满意度调查等措施,收集用户对推荐结果的反馈。根据这些反馈结果,持续调整和优化推荐算法及模型参数,以提高推荐效果。

数据驱动的设计,怎样在App里开发智能推荐系统三.数据驱动设计的实践案例

以某电商App为例,通过引入智能推荐系统,显著提高了用户购买转化率。该App首先收集了用户的浏览、购买、评价等多方面数据;然后使用协同过滤算法进行商品推荐。通过持续优化模型和进行AB测试,推荐系统的准确性逐渐提高。最终,用户购买转化率比之前提高了30%,用户满意度也大幅提升。

数据驱动的设计是开发智能推荐系统的关键。通过深入挖掘和分析用户数据,我们可以更准确地理解用户需求,从而为用户提供更加个性化和有价值的推荐内容。这不仅能提升用户体验和粘性,还能为App带来更多的商业机会和价值。因此,在App开发过程中,不妨将智能推荐系统视为提升竞争力的重要工具,让数据为产品赋予力量。

以上就是数据驱动的设计,怎样在App里开发智能推荐系统的详细内容,更多请关注php中文网其它相关文章!

相关标签:
驱动精灵
驱动精灵

驱动精灵基于驱动之家十余年的专业数据积累,驱动支持度高,已经为数亿用户解决了各种电脑驱动问题、系统故障,是目前有效的驱动软件,有需要的小伙伴快来保存下载体验吧!

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号